We looked at data on temporary closures, reduced services in B.C. hospitals this year. Here’s what we found

B.C.’s health-care system is experiencing historic pressures as a result of the ongoing COVID-19 pandemic and staffing shortages, which have led to numerous service reductions and emergency room closures, primarily in rural areas.

CBC News has independently verified data tracking ER closures across the province, as well as diversions and closures of maternity units.
